Abstract
The ability of microwave radar to detect and characterize obstacles below the sea surface is dependent on the extent to which perturbations of the surface geometry and dynamics resulting from either movement of the obstacle or disruption of waves and currents due to the presence of the obstacle can be discriminated from the natural state of the surface in the absence of such obstacles. In this paper we report recent results from a systematic investigation of the radar signatures of some classes of submerged obstacles and examine some of the practical issues which can arise in operational implementation of a sensing capability.
